Output d2e62a8647060892383f0d56fdc2f8ec6312ebfcef5829077666c8b969e8e472:1

value
15474777526
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50b2c3c65cfd9ccbf8597bd65025a34d3e7000f9 OP_EQUALVERIFY OP_CHECKSIG
address
18MhD93bsohHWBXW7DAxQR6vTEnDwX9oua
transaction
d2e62a8647060892383f0d56fdc2f8ec6312ebfcef5829077666c8b969e8e472
spent
true